What Are Dental Bridges?

A fixed dental bridge is permanently placed in the open space to replace one or more missing teeth. It is designed and carefully placed between nearby supporting teeth by the extraction site. The artificial replacement for the missing tooth is known as a pontic tooth, with the purpose of restoring both aesthetics and chewing ability at the same time.

Traditional Dental Bridge

These permanent bridge teeth are supported with crowns that are secured onto neighboring teeth on either side of the bridge.

Cantilever Dental Bridge

This design is used if you only have one adjacent tooth to support the bridge.

Typical steps of the dental bridge procedure include:

01

We begin with a comprehensive oral exam, using diagnostic imaging for evaluation.

02

The supporting teeth are prepared to hold the supporting crowns.

03

Digital impressions are used to custom-fabricate your dental bridge.

04

If necessary, you will wear a temporary dental bridge while the permanent restoration is created.

05

The final restoration is secured in your mouth, offering long-lasting results.
